Abstract
The utility model relates to a connector structure with combined terminals of double surfaces of a tongue plate body, belonging to the electronic products. One single insertion port is internally provided with a first connecting port and a second connecting port, the first connecting port is provided with a plurality of first terminal assemblies which are in accordance to USB (universal serial bus) transport protocols, and the first connecting port is provided with a plurality of second terminal assemblies which are in accordance to small size memory card transport protocols on a presetting surface, and the second connecting port is arranged at the side position where the first connecting port is deviated from the second terminal assemblies, and the second connecting port is provided with a plurality of third terminal assemblies which are in accordance to large size memory card transport protocols; by adopting the above structure, the connectors with different specifications can be inserted on the same device, thereby having advantages of saving time and simplifying steps.

Background technology
Along with development of science and technology, develop at present and multiple different electronic installation with auxiliary user, and electronic installation comprises display, computer, camera, plug-in device (dish with oneself) or the like, but for the data or the signal that can read this electronic installation connects, then must have corresponding mating connector, and the connector pattern of various electronic installations is all different, for example: USB series and HDMI series, DIIVA series, E-SATA series, Display port series, SD series (SD, SDHC, SDXC), MS series (MS Pro Duo, MSHG Pro Duo, MSXC Pro Duo, Micro MS, Micro MSHG, MicroMSXC), MMC series (MMC, RS-MMC, MMC Plus, RS-MMC Plus, MMC Micro), CF series (I, II), XD series (XD, SMC) or SIM series or the like, and above-mentioned connector must use specific corresponding connector to connect respectively, therefore has many connection wire rods with different connector.
And at present at present the connector of normal use be USB connector, therefore the many tools of many electronic installations are provided with USB connector and connect for the user, other pattern connector then is provided with on individual device in addition, but, when user's desire is planted connector out of the ordinary, then can connect the staggered complexity of wire rod and maybe must use problems such as adapter switching, also inconvenient for the user, especially for system manufacturer, often to constantly test the electronic installation of various different size connector patterns, very trouble.
The utility model content
The purpose of this utility model is to provide the structure of the connector of the two-sided terminal combination of a kind of hyoplastron body, solve the user can not be on same device the problem of plant different size pattern connector.
The structure of the connector of the two-sided terminal combination of a kind of hyoplastron body mainly comprises:
One insulating body comprises single interface;
One first connectivity port is arranged in this interface, and this first connectivity port is provided with the first terminal group of a plurality of USB of meeting host-host protocols, and this first connectivity port is provided with a plurality of second terminal group that meet the small memory card host-host protocol in a predetermined face;
One second connectivity port is arranged in this interface and is located at this first connectivity port and deviates from this second terminal group side place, and this second connectivity port is provided with a plurality of the 3rd terminal group that meet large-scale memory card host-host protocol; And
One screening can is fixedly set on this insulating body, and this screening can coats this insulating body, first connectivity port and this second connectivity port.
Wherein extend a tongue piece in this first connectivity port;
Wherein this small memory card can be T-Flash card (Trans Flash), Micro SD serial card, Micro MS (M2) serial card or MMS Micro serial card one of them;
Wherein this large-scale memory card can be SD serial card, MS serial card, mini SD serial card, MS Duo serial card, MMC serial card, XD serial card or SIM serial card one of them;
Wherein this screening can is metal or plastic material.
Advantage of the present utility model is: effectively integrated memory card slot and USB slot, further reached the practical improvement of saving circuit board space, can in a large number and be widely used in personal computer or mobile computer.

Embodiment
With shown in the accompanying drawing 2, find out that by knowing among the figure connector 10 comprises as accompanying drawing 1:
One insulating body 11 comprises single interface 111;
One first connectivity port 12, be arranged in this interface 111, this first connectivity port 12 is provided with the first terminal group 121 of a plurality of USB of meeting host-host protocols, and this first connectivity port 12 is provided with a plurality of second terminal group 122 that meet the small memory card host-host protocol in a predetermined face;
One second connectivity port 13 is arranged in this interface 111 and is located at this first connectivity port 12 and deviates from this second terminal group, 122 side places, and this second connectivity port 13 is provided with a plurality of the 3rd terminal group 131 that meet large-scale memory card host-host protocol; And
One screening can 14 is fixedly set on this insulating body 11, and this screening can 14 coats this insulating body 11, first connectivity port 12 and this second connectivity port 13.
Wherein, this small memory card can be T-Flash card (Trans Flash), Micro SD serial card, Micro MS (M2) serial card or MMS Micro serial card one of them.
And, this large-scale memory card can be SD serial card, MS serial card, mini SD serial card, MS Duo serial card, MMC serial card, XD serial card or SIM serial card one of them.
By above-mentioned structure, form design, be described as follows with regard to use situation of the present utility model, as accompanying drawing 1 to shown in the accompanying drawing 8, find out by knowing among the figure, this connector 10 mainly comprises a single interface 111, one first connectivity port 12 and one second connectivity port 13 are set in this interface 111, this first connectivity port 12 is provided with the first terminal group 121 of a plurality of USB of meeting host-host protocols and in a predetermined face a plurality of second terminal group 122 that meet the small memory card host-host protocol is set, and this second connectivity port 13 is located at this first connectivity port 12 and is deviated from this second terminal group, 122 side places, this second connectivity port 13 is provided with a plurality of the 3rd terminal group 131 that meet large-scale memory card host-host protocol, as shown in Figure 3, (as: T-Flash card (Trans Flash) when user's desire plant small memory card 20, Micro SD serial card, Micro MS (M2) serial card or MMS Micro), this memory card can be inserted in these 12 tops, first connectivity port (its top only is an embodiment wherein, below also can be) can be read or access by this second terminal group 122;
And when user's desire plant USB joint 30, as shown in Figure 5, this interface 111 of USB joint 30 directly can being planted can transmit message by this first terminal group 121 to read or access;
In addition, when user's desire is planted large-scale memory card 40 (as: SD serial card, MS serial card, mini SD serial card, MS Duo serial card, MMC serial card, XD serial card or SIM serial card), as shown in Figure 8, this large-scale memory card 40 can be inserted in these 12 belows, first connectivity port (its below only is an embodiment wherein, above also can be) can be read or access by the 3rd terminal group 131.
